Professor Alice Roberts travels two thousand miles by train in search of a greater understanding of the Roman Empire for Channel 4’s popular TV series The Roman Empire by Train with Alice Roberts. This book delivers more depth and context than the TV series possibly can, using four broad narrative strands. Alice explores what everyday life was like for ordinary citizens of the Roman Empire and reveals the extraordinary developments in technology, law, lifestyle, politics, health and education that remain to this day and how these fed into the birth, expansion and collapse of the empire. She also shares her experiences from the journey itself, including her drawings and personal anecdotes.
